    How much does an Event Production make in Minnesota?

    As of May 28, 2026, the average annual pay for an Event Production in Minnesota is $33,839 a year.

    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$16.27 an hour. This is the equivalent of $650/week or $2,819/month.

    While ZipRecruiter is seeing salaries as high as $43,094 and as low as $22,037, the majority of Event Production salaries currently range between $30,400 (25th percentile) to $36,200 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$40,155 annually in Minnesota. The average pay range for an Event Production varies little (about 5800), which suggests that regardless of location, there are not many opportunities for increased pay or advancement, even with several years of experience.

    Minnesota ranks number 50 out of 50 states nationwide for Event Production salaries.
